A big 3 points from a fairly lacklustre performance. First half was poor by any standards and whilst City worked very hard to keep closing us down the midfield was MIA. We lacked energy and tempo. Hecky looked like he might kill someone at halftime! Better second half. We looked better with McAtee on (but I thought Sharp actually made more of a difference) and playing higher and suddenly there was some room to play in. It was a bit heart in mouth at times but in the end they faded second half.

Davies - 7 - Made a decent save first half but it was his command of area and willingness to sweep up behind the defence which impressed. Although, there was one he should probably have left!
Lowe - 6.5 - Thought he had one of his better games. It's noticeable he's now trying to get a foot in and get to the ball first and he kept going to the very end with a great cross for Jebbo.
Robbo - 6 - Caught on the ball, which he managed to get away with, but ok generally.
Egan - 8 - PoM for me. He actually got really angry which seemed to spur him on. Made a number of great interceptions, tackles and steal and drove us forward second half.
Anel - 6.5 - Made a few key interceptions but also almost let them in when losing the ball going forward. He did that thing where he just stands as a striker again leaving a 20 million midfielder to cover for him!
Baldock - 7 - Solid and shows great anticipation and touch at times. Lovely turn in their box and was his usual clam self
Fleck - 5 - All the midfielders were slow and off their game first half. They man marked them out the game but Fleck looked slow and behind the play and was rightly subbed off.
Doyle - 5 - I thought he had a poor game. Played a couple of players into danger with stupid balls and nothing really came off for him.
Berge - 6 - Probably our best midfielder, but not saying much. He was slow at times again but was at least demanding the ball. Covering back was better as well.
Ndiaye - 6 - Looked tired and tied himself up in knots at times. Not his night but picked the pass for the winner. Put in a shift as per always.
McBurnie - 5.5 - Had moments and flashes but they were few and far between. Nothing really sticks and he seems slow to react to things.

Subs:

McAtee - 6 - We looked better with him coming on and he has a happy knack of being in the right place. Took his goal well but the rest was a bit mixed.
Sharp - 7 - I thought Sharp coming on made the difference. He was involved in everything and used his experience well to relieve pressure.
Norwood - 6.5 - Again, I thought we looked more dangerous with him on and his willingness to put in first time balls was dangerous.
Jebbo - 5.5 - Held the ball up well on the touchlines and looked lively but that was a terrible miss.

Bristol City - You have to give Pearson credit as they had our card first half. Looked much more energetic and didn't let any of our midfielders play. They seemed to fade second half and there was much more space for us to play in. No one really stood out but they have a few decent looking young players. That Bell lad caused us issues.
